Output 05a5f89ee108a868ed78c062b9129c4e22f5c89d571dc8624f491424b9d93ecb:15

value
26080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091667da29e6def2040ca990cb49aaa38cb7b296 OP_EQUAL
address
M8jD9vu5UoWcEv95VJeoHoLb7dKWs37W54
transaction
05a5f89ee108a868ed78c062b9129c4e22f5c89d571dc8624f491424b9d93ecb
spent
true